2 leaders of Biplav-led outfit held in Syangja



SYANGJA: Leaders and cadres of the Netra Bikram Chand Biplav-led Communist Party of Nepal (CPN) are being arrested from different parts of the country after the government banned their activities. On Friday, police nabbed two leaders of the outfit.

DSP Nabin Krishna Bhandari at District Police Office, Syangja informed that District Secretary of the party Gokul Parajuli and Chairman of Worker’s Union Govinda Oli ‘Jeewan’ were arrested from Putalibazaar-13 while they were running away on a motorcycle.

Police have kept a close tab on leaders and cadres of the outfit after government banned their activities.
